CONSPIRACY THEORY: The Princes in the Tower

About this episode

In 1483, two boys, the 12-year-old King of England and his 9-year-old brother, were placed in the Tower of London by their uncle, who had sworn to protect them. Instead, he declared them illegitimate and crowned himself King Richard III. The princes were seen playing in the Tower gardens that summer, and then they vanished. Their uncle had the clearest motive, but so did his closest ally and the man who later overthrew him, leaving three suspects and no confession. In 1674, workers found the skeletons of two children beneath a Tower staircase, bones now sealed in a Westminster Abbey tomb that has repeatedly been denied DNA testing. In this episode of Conspiracy Theories, Cults, & Crimes, Vanessa Richardson examines one of the oldest cold cases in history, the three suspects who all had reason to want the boys dead, and the mystery modern science could finally solve if anyone would open the tomb.
